原文:實現一個hoverDelay延遲hover

實現一個hoverDelay延遲hover author: TiffanysBear 需求背景 經常在頁面開發中,需要使用hover事件來觸發相應的網絡請求或頁面DOM元素顯示切換,需要考慮的問題就有了: hover動作非常快,如果一hover就請求,會造成多余請求的浪費,造成后端接口不必要的壓力 如何判斷這個用戶hover是想做一定的操作,而不是鼠標誤觸 構造這個hover延遲的時候,怎樣封裝 ...

2019-08-06 11:10 0 559 推薦指數:

查看詳情

Vue實現hover功能

用vue實現元素獲得鼠標焦點的功能,這里有兩個方法,@mouseenter 和 @mouseleave , @mouseenter 是值元素獲得鼠標焦點后執行的方法,而@mouseleave 是當元素執行了 @mouseenter 離開之后執行的方法,兩種都能獲得元素DOM,從來用來修改 ...

Thu Apr 01 21:43:00 CST 2021 0 3760
js的hover實現方法。

onMouseEnter={(utils.isiPad() || utils.isPhone()) ? () => { } : () => this.toggleHoverEn ...

Thu May 09 22:58:00 CST 2019 0 2566
在AngularJS中實現一個延遲加載的Directive

所謂的延遲加載通常是:直到用戶交互時才加載。如何實現延遲加載呢?需要搞清楚三個方面:1、html元素的哪個屬性需要延遲加載?2、需要對數據源的哪個字段進行延遲加載?3、通過什么事件來觸發延遲加載?自定義的Directive的頁面表現大致是這樣: 以上 ...

Mon Jan 25 19:34:00 CST 2016 0 1840
一個簡單的tr:hover效果

  昨天,搞項目的時候,在一個小問題上卡了40分鍾,現在想想,還是平時比較少去注意一些細節,經過這次,一定要去多注意細節了。   好了廢話不多說,我現在說明下遇到的問題,一個表格中,要求是當鼠標滑過每一行時,該行就有高亮顯示,前天寫的時候感覺比較簡單啊,就是在表格里面的tr加上一個hover樣式 ...

Thu Jun 19 01:30:00 CST 2014 4 6447
css實現菜單欄效果以及用hover屬性去控制另一個元素樣式的問題

實現鼠標經過 你好 顯示 我一點也不好 的效果方法: 首先使用display:none 隱藏要顯示的菜單欄元素,當鼠標經過一個元素時將它的display改成block。 鼠標經過one元素時怎么選擇two元素的問題: 1.當兩個p元素為包含關系時,選擇器 ...

Sun Apr 21 07:56:00 CST 2019 0 575
vue--實現hover效果

css: js: export default { data() { return { showCode:false }; ...

Thu Dec 26 23:46:00 CST 2019 0 6101
JS實現延遲

var xx = [1, 232, 34354, 554665, 4535, 5345345, 344535, 9890]; for (var i = 0; i < xx.leng ...

Fri Apr 10 23:32:00 CST 2020 0 864
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M